NASA Astronauts Visit JPL
Mission specialists Stephanie Wilson and Piers Sellers spoke at JPL about their recent shuttle mission to the International Space Station. Sellers performed three spacewalks to test the robotic arm, while Wilson operated it from inside the space station. Wilson worked at JPL before joining the astronaut program.